Did you know the air inside your home can sometimes be more polluted than the air outside? That's why it's important to take steps to enhance indoor air quality. Fortunately, there are many simple things you can do to make a big difference. Kick off by regularly vacuuming your home to minimize dust mites and allergens. Make sure to open windows your home frequently to allow fresh air to circulate. And consider using an air purifier to remove airborne particles. These small changes can dramatically enhance the air you breathe and make a big difference in your overall health and oxygen-rich air well-being.
- Evaluate using natural cleaning products to avoid harsh chemicals that can pollute indoor air.
- Choose plants that are known to filter the air, such as spider plants or snake plants.
- Track humidity levels in your home and use a humidifier or dehumidifier to keep them within a healthy range.
